Brian P. Brooks, the former chief legal counsel for Coinbase, has been tapped to take over the U.S. Treasury’s banking-focused bureau.

According to an announcement from the United States Office of the Comptroller of the Currency (OCC) on May 21, Brooks has been chosen as the new head of the OCC, this comes a mere seven weeks after leaving Coinbase’s legal team.

Brooks will be taking over for Joseph Otting, who is leaving midway through his term
